Barclays Miles & More - Barclaycards Bait and Switch: Offering 30,000 miles for Premier Miles & More card - switching to 5,000 miles Wilmington Delaware
I received an offer for the Premier Miles & More World Master credit card with a total welcome bonus of 30,000 miles and free companion tickets from Barclays.
As an alternative they offered the Miles & More World Master credit card with a total welcome bonus of 22,500 miles (lower annual fee).
This sounded almost too good to be true and I called to apply. CSR read the entire conditions for the two cards and asked me "Which card do you want, the Premier Miles & More World Master Card or the Miles & More World Master card ?"
I told her "The Premier Miles and More World Master card".
A few days later I received a "Miles & More" credit card in the mail and was assuming that it was the card that I had applied for. After having used it a few times I was surprised that I received only 5,000 miles on my Miles & More account. I called Barclays and they explained to me "You were not approved for the Premier Miles & More World Master card, that's why we sent you the default credit card which is the Platinum Miles and More card"
CSR did not explain that they would automatically open a "default account" if I was not approved for the card that I had applied for. Since the conversation that I had with their CSR when applying for a credit card was recorded I will report them to the Comptroller of the Currency. I believe that these practices are fraudulent.
My credit was good enough to receive a credit line of $ 17,000 with Citi cards, I had to call them to reduce the credit line because they wanted to increase it another time. I have a total of 5 credit cards, one with unlimited credit by AMEX. Thats why I believe that Barclays never had any intentions to send me the card with a 30,000 miles welcome bonus.
This offer is just a marketing strategy that turns into their "default card" when people apply. What really bothers me is that I had to close this account when i found out that it was not what I had applied for and this lowers my credit score. I would never have applied for their "default card".

I signed up for Miles and More MasterCard. In order to be approved, you need to have excellent credit. If you have less than excellent credit, you may get a card that requires less than excellent credit, but also has less benefits.
I was instantly approved online, and after receiving my approval email a few minutes after the online approval, I called Barclay Bank and asked them to expedite delivery. They send me my card via FedEx Priority Saturday delivery and waived the associated fees.
The card I received was exactly as advertised. I received 20,000 miles after I used the card the first time, and then I received 30,000 more miles after I spent $5,000 within the first 90 days. I also received a companion ticket to use.
Everything I got was exactly as advertised, and I have already used the 50k miles to travel to Europe.
